DBA Data[Home] [Help]

PACKAGE: APPS.IGS_PR_VAL_PRA

Source


1 PACKAGE IGS_PR_VAL_PRA AUTHID CURRENT_USER AS
2 /* $Header: IGSPR04S.pls 115.5 2002/11/29 02:44:39 nsidana ship $ */
3 /*
4 ||  Bug ID 1956374 - Removal of Duplicate Program Units from OSS.
5 ||  Removed program unit (PRGP_VAL_OU_ACTIVE) - from the spec and body. -- kdande
6 */
7   -------------------------------------------------------------------------------------------
8   --Change History:
9   --Who         When            What
10   --avenkatr    29-AUG-2001    Bug Id : 1956374. Removed procedure "crsp_val_cty_closed"
11   -------------------------------------------------------------------------------------------
12   --
13   -- bug id : 1956374
14   -- sjadhav , 28-aug-2001
15   -- removed FUNCTION enrp_val_att_closed
16   --
17   --
18   -- Validate the IGS_PR_RU_APPL record.
19   FUNCTION prgp_val_pra_rqrd(
20   p_s_relation_type IN VARCHAR2 ,
21   p_progression_rule_cd IN VARCHAR2 ,
22   p_rul_sequence_number IN NUMBER ,
23   p_ou_org_unit_cd IN VARCHAR2 ,
24   p_ou_start_dt IN DATE ,
25   p_course_type IN VARCHAR2 ,
26   p_crv_course_cd IN VARCHAR2 ,
27   p_crv_version_number IN NUMBER ,
28   p_sca_person_id IN NUMBER ,
29   p_sca_course_cd IN VARCHAR2 ,
30   p_pro_progression_rule_cat IN VARCHAR2 ,
31   p_pro_pra_sequence_number IN NUMBER ,
32   p_pro_sequence_number IN NUMBER ,
33   p_spo_person_id IN NUMBER ,
34   p_spo_course_cd IN VARCHAR2 ,
35   p_spo_sequence_number IN NUMBER ,
36   p_message_name OUT NOCOPY VARCHAR2 )
37 RETURN BOOLEAN;
38 PRAGMA RESTRICT_REFERENCES(prgp_val_pra_rqrd, WNDS);
39   --
40   -- Validate that the IGS_PR_RU_CAT is not closed.
41   FUNCTION prgp_val_prgc_closed(
42   p_progression_rule_cat IN VARCHAR2 ,
43   p_message_name OUT NOCOPY VARCHAR2 )
44 RETURN BOOLEAN;
45 PRAGMA RESTRICT_REFERENCES(prgp_val_prgc_closed, WNDS);
46   --
47   -- Validate that the IGS_PR_RULE is not closed.
48   FUNCTION prgp_val_prr_closed(
49   p_progression_rule_cd IN VARCHAR2 ,
50   p_message_name OUT NOCOPY VARCHAR2 )
51 RETURN BOOLEAN;
52 PRAGMA RESTRICT_REFERENCES(prgp_val_prr_closed, WNDS);
53   --
54   -- Validate the IGS_PS_COURSE version is active.
55   FUNCTION crsp_val_crv_active(
56   p_course_cd IN IGS_PS_VER_ALL.course_cd%TYPE ,
57   p_version_number IN IGS_PS_VER_ALL.version_number%TYPE ,
58   p_message_name OUT NOCOPY VARCHAR2)
59 RETURN BOOLEAN;
60 PRAGMA RESTRICT_REFERENCES(crsp_val_crv_active, WNDS);
61 END IGS_PR_VAL_PRA;